About 1-[(2-cyclopentyloxy-3-methoxyphenyl)methyl]-3-[3-(cyclopropylmethoxy)propyl]-2-methylguanidine;hydroiodide

1-[(2-cyclopentyloxy-3-methoxyphenyl)methyl]-3-[3-(cyclopropylmethoxy)propyl]-2-methylguanidine;hydroiodide (PubChem CID 111564784) has the molecular formula C22H36IN3O3 and a molecular weight of 517.45 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 1-[(2-cyclopentyloxy-3-methoxyphenyl)methyl]-3-[3-(cyclopropylmethoxy)propyl]-2-methylguanidine;hydroiodide.
